jsonFilters empty after bookmark load

Hey,

 

I need help with bookmarks and the filter api in a custom visual. Right now I am applying filters like this (I need to filter my own visual and all other visual):

    // Invoke the self filter.
    this._visualHost.applyJsonFilter(
      filterList,
      "general",
      "selfFilter",
      powerbi.FilterAction.merge
    );
    // Invoke the filter for the other visuals.
    this._visualHost.applyJsonFilter(
      filterList,
      "general",
      "filter",
      powerbi.FilterAction.merge
    );

 

In the update method I get the restored filter values from the jsonFilter object like this:

const jsonFilterValues: powerbi.IFilter[] = options.jsonFilters;

 

This work fine if I just switch between pages of the report with actives filters, but this does not work, if I save a filter state in a bookmark. If I filter the report with my visual, create a new bookmark and select it afterwards the created filters are gone and the options.jsonFilters object is empty. What am I missing?
